Dublin Zoning Code 153.149 regulates outdoor lighting with full cutoff fixture requirements in commercial and PUD districts. Light spillover onto adjacent residential properties cannot exceed 0.5 foot-candles at the property line.
Dublin is not formally an IDA Dark Sky community, but the Lighting Code requires fully-shielded fixtures for commercial, institutional, and multi-family developments over 8 units. Maximum 30-foot pole heights in most districts; parking lots must reduce lighting by 50 percent or turn off non-security lighting after business hours. Residential landscape lighting under 60 watts per fixture is largely unregulated but cannot create nuisance glare. Bridge Street District has specific pedestrian-scale lighting standards.
Code enforcement notices require fixture replacement or shielding within 30-60 days; unresolved violations up to 500 dollars per day.
